The Aurora Advantage

Aurora stands out as a reusable spaceplane designed for conventional runways. This innovative approach offers a more cost-effective and frequent access to space, potentially transforming the launch logistics and mobility landscape. By combining aircraft-style operations with advanced manufacturing techniques, Aurora represents a significant step forward in making space exploration more sustainable and efficient.

3D Printing: A Game-Changer

One of the key enablers of Aurora's success is 3D printing technology. Dawn Aerospace utilizes this cutting-edge method to produce critical propulsion components, including rocket engine technology developed in collaboration with the European Space Agency (ESA). This approach not only reduces weight but also enhances efficiency, paving the way for lighter and more agile spacecraft.

Expanding Horizons: Satellite Propulsion and Refueling

The funding round isn't just about Aurora. It also fuels Dawn's satellite propulsion business and their ambitious Loop project - an in-orbit satellite refueling network. By extending satellite lifespans and offering greater orbital flexibility, Loop supports emerging service models for managing space-based assets. This development is a game-changer for the satellite services industry, promising longer-duration operations and enhanced mission capabilities.
